Beginning Genealogy & “Brick Walls” Planned For Fulton County Genealogical Society Meeting

By Newspaper StaffJanuary 2, 2017Updated:January 2, 2017No Comments1 Min Read
Share Facebook Twitter Email Copy Link

DELTA – The next Fulton County Genealogical Society meeting is Tuesday, Jan. 10 at 7 p.m. when members will try to help anyone with Beginning Genealogy or “Brick Walls” questions. “Brick Walls” are those obstacles you find when you just don’t know where to look to find the answers to family research questions.

If you need help getting started with researching your family’s history or if you have been tracing your family for a while and just need some help, please come to this meeting and we will do our best to help.

Fulton County Genealogical Society meetings are held at Trinity Lutheran Church. 410 Taylor St., Delta. Parking and entry is on the back side of the church.

Visitors are welcome. Hope to see you there!
